如何破译脚本时间限制

如何破译脚本时间限制

作者:Elara发布时间:2026-03-03阅读时长:0 分钟阅读次数:4

用户关注问题

Q
脚本时间限制会对我的程序执行产生什么影响?

我在运行脚本时遇到了时间限制,导致脚本没有完成全部任务。这种限制具体会带来哪些问题?

A

脚本时间限制可能导致任务未完整执行

脚本时间限制通常是为了防止程序长时间占用资源。如果脚本在设定时间内未完成,系统可能会强制终止它,导致未执行完的任务丢失或者数据未保存,从而影响程序的正常运行和结果的完整性。

Q
调整脚本的时间限制有哪些可行的方法?

我想延长脚本的执行时间,有没有办法可以调整或者绕过现有的时间限制?

A

通过配置环境或优化脚本可以延长执行时间

针对脚本时间限制,可以通过修改服务器配置文件、增加超时时间参数或者使用循环分块处理任务等方法修改限制。此外,优化算法和减少不必要的计算量也能有效缩短执行时间,避免触发限制。

Q
如何检测脚本执行是否接近时间限制?

运行脚本时,想实时了解已经消耗的时间,避免时间超限,有什么检测技巧或者工具推荐?

A

利用计时器和日志监控脚本执行时间

可以在脚本中加入计时功能,通过记录开始时间与当前时间间隔,判断执行时间接近限制。此外,借助日志记录关键步骤和耗时情况,可以帮助监控执行进度,及时调整或终止脚本避免超时。